Deep-link routing runbook — Fernwheel app. When users report links opening the web fallback instead of the app, first check the LinkLattice resolver health dashboard. If resolution latency exceeds 2s, the mobile client times out and degrades silently. Restart the resolver pods one at a time; never drain all three, or cached route tables are lost. After restart, verify routes with the smoke script in tools/linkcheck. The script authenticates against the internal RouteForge service using the key that follows.

gateway credential: kto3_qfe

## Deploying the Gatewick Proctor Queue

Deploys are pretty painless: push to main, wait for the pipeline, then watch the queue drain dashboard for five minutes. If candidates pile up mid-exam, roll back first and ask questions later — the queue replays safely. Everything the workers care about lives in one config block, shown here for reference.

settings of bafof-yagef:
JOROX_PIN=8740
JOROX_TENANT=pelox
JOROX_METRICS_HOST=metrics.jorox.qorvelworks.internal
JOROX_SEAL=seal_c78f63c1
JOROX_STANDBY_TEAM=norax

The LockerLine API grants laundry-locker access in two stages: the client first calls POST /v2/reservations to claim a compartment at a Tumblewick Hub, then exchanges the reservation code for a short-lived unlock credential. Reviewers should confirm the exchange endpoint rejects expired codes. All unlock requests must authenticate with the token below.

portal login ticket: eyJhbGciOiJIUzI1NiIsInR5cCI6IkpXVCJ9.eyJzdWIiOiI0Z4ywpUMsBIn0.ca5FVhkdBXa3

Ticket #— Floor 9 Opening Prep, Brindlemoor House

Hi facilities folks, Floor 9 opens to staff next Monday and we need a few things squared away before then. Lift access is live, but the two side doors by the kitchenette are still on the old lock config — please reprogram them before Friday. Also, signage for the quiet rooms hasn't arrived, so pop up the temporary printed ones for now. Until the badge readers sync, the interim door code for Floor 9 is below.

door code, bajop-bajog: bdg-DSWAC-43621